What's the average time to fill a machine operator role?

The average time to fill a machine operator role is 71 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.

What skills do machine operators tend to have?

According to the candidates available on Smart Sourcing, the most common skills for a machine operator include: communication skills, leadership and organizational skills.

What licenses or certifications are common for a machine operator?

Common licenses or certifications for machine operators include: Driver's License, Forklift Certification and CPR.
